titleOfInvention | Control device for industrial manipulator |
abstract | (57) [Abstract] [Purpose] To provide a control device for an industrial manipulator that can quickly drive the entire operating range and surely stops a driven part at a soft limit position. A controller for an industrial manipulator of a master-slave type configured such that a slave arm operates in accordance with the operation of a master arm, and has a speed characteristic such that the speed becomes zero at soft limit positions 01a and 01b. Is set in advance, and a predetermined deceleration range B terminating at the soft limit positions 01a and 01b, In C, if the actual speed command value is less than or equal to the maximum speed command value I, the actual speed command value is used, and if it exceeds the maximum speed command value I, this maximum speed command value I is used. By controlling the motors of the respective axes, the slave arm is surely stopped at the soft limit positions 01a and 01b. |
